Introduction

Welcome to Multi-Tech's stand-alone Voice/IP Gateway, the
MultiVOIP model MVP110. The MVP110 allows analog voice
and fax communication over an IP network. Multi-Tech's voice/
fax gateway technology allows voice/fax communication to be
transmitted, with no additional expense, over your existing IP
network, which has traditionally been data-only. To access this
free voice and fax communication, all you have to do is
connect the MVP110 to your telephone equipment, and then to
your existing Internet connection. Once configured, the
MVP110 then allows voice and fax to travel down the same
path as your traditional data communications.
The MVP110 supports the H.323 standards-based protocol
enabling your MVP110 to communicate with other third-party
VOIP Gateways or other endpoints that support the H.323
protocol, such as Microsoft NetMeeting
defines how endpoints make and receive calls, how endpoints
negotiate a common set of audio and data capabilities, and
how information is formatted and sent over the network. This
version of the software also supports communication with a
Multi-Tech MVPGK1 Gatekeeper or an optional 3rd party
H.323 Gatekeeper which, when enabled, maintains its own
phonebook database, pre-registers all endpoints, controls the
bandwidth, and handles all conferencing issues such as
transferring of calls.
